The size of Rivett is approximately 1.6 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 9.4% of total area. The population of Rivett in 2016 was 3193 people. By 2021 the population was 3354 showing a population growth of 5.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Rivett is 40-49 years. Households in Rivett are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Rivett work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 73.10% of the homes in Rivett were owner-occupied compared with 70.90% in 2016.
Rivett has 1,431 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Rivett have seen a 35.16%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 30.24% increase. As at 30 November 2025:
